1 more results for car supplies perth 
		  
		  
    		
    
    Balcatta, Australia
            Here at Odin Auto Parts, we have acquired a solid reputation for providing top-quality car parts at the most competitive prices in the area.Our team can supply new or reconditioned car parts that all come with a range of quality guarantees. We are also members of the MTAWA Industry Advisory body. Wh…